Output 17d068bb569651d744c6878003746ebcd715eb747a70655112c84413fc600446:0

value
26330400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3e57d620fd67589e88e82fca5182b5ed4bd8882 OP_EQUAL
address
3Gdcz3MWPzGSQKHXCqQC21frpx5hSrp7zS
transaction
17d068bb569651d744c6878003746ebcd715eb747a70655112c84413fc600446
confirmations
337439
spent
true